Details
-
Bug
-
Status: Resolved
-
Resolution: Done
-
Helium
-
None
-
None
-
Operating System: All
Platform: All
-
1637
Description
Currently the the RemoteRpcImplementation and RpcBroker classes make blocking RPC calls. These can be made async. RemoteRpcImplementation#executeMsg returns a ListenableFuture so we can return a SettableFuture and set it’s result async via an OnComplete callback on the scala Future. Similar in RpcBroker.